Subject: Re: [PATCH] ath11k: Add dynamic tcl ring selection logic with retry mechanism

Sriram R <srirrama@codeaurora.org> wrote:

> IPQ8074 HW supports three TCL rings for tx. Currently these rings
> are mapped based on the Access categories, viz. VO, VI, BE, BK.
> In case, one of the traffic type dominates, then it could stress
> the same tcl rings. Rather, it would be optimal to make use of all
> the rings in a round robin fashion irrespective of the traffic type
> so that the load could be evenly distributed among all the rings.
> Also, in case the selected ring is busy or full, a retry mechanism
> is used to ensure other available ring is selected without dropping
> the packet.
> 
> In SMP systems, this change avoids a single CPU from getting hogged
> when heavy traffic of same category is transmitted.
> The tx completion interrupts corresponding to the used tcl ring
> would be more which causes the assigned CPU to get hogged.
> Distribution of tx packets to different tcl rings helps balance
> this load.
